“Fair Play” is an erotic thriller that is streaming on Netflix starring Phoebe Dynevor and Alden Ehrenreich.
So let’s dive into some trivia and facts about the new film.
- Fair Play is a 2023 American thriller film
- It is written and directed by Chloe Domont
- This marks her feature directorial debut
- It stars Phoebe Dynevor, Alden Ehrenreich, Eddie Marsan, and Rich Sommer
- The film follows a young couple whose relationship starts to unravel following an unexpected promotion at a cutthroat hedge fund firm
- Fair Play premiered at the 2023 Sundance Film Festival on January 20, 2023
- It was released in select theaters on September 29, 2023
- It was released on streaming by Netflix on October 6, 2023
- The film received positive reviews from critics
- On the review aggregator website Rotten Tomatoes, the film holds a 87% rating
- Based on 180 critics’ reviews
- With an average rating of 7.4/10
- The website’s consensus reads: “With assured style that’s at times reminiscent of the best ’90s nail-biting thrillers, Fair Play juxtaposes premarital disharmony with greed and gender politics in the cutthroat finance world”
- Metacritic, which uses a weighted average, assigned the film a score of 74 out of 100
- Based on 43 critics
- Indicating “generally favorable” reviews
- The film was announced in December 2021, with Chloe Domont writing and directing, and Alden Ehrenreich and Phoebe Dynevor set to star in the film
- Production began in January 2022 in Serbia
- In February, Sebastian de Souza, Eddie Marsan and Rich Sommer joined the cast

- The film’s streaming release was originally scheduled for October 13, before it was moved up

- Shortly after, Netflix acquired distribution rights to the film
- This happened after a bidding war between half a dozen companies including Searchlight Pictures and Neon, for $20 million
- It had its international premiere at the 48th Toronto International Film Festival on September 11, 2023
- For its European premiere, the film was shown in the section Feature Film Competition of the 19th Zurich Film Festival in late September 2023
